inflearn logo
강의

講義

知識共有

WEB2 - Node.js

パッケージマネージャとPM2

패키지 매니저 오류

解決済みの質問

421

jinseung

投稿した質問数 4

0

pm2 start main.js --watch 를 입력했을때 [PM2][ERROR] Script already launched, add -f option to force re-execution 라고 오류가 뜹니다.

node.js

回答 1

1

communityai8509

안녕하세요, 인프런 AI 인턴이에요.

해당 오류는 이미 pm2로 실행 중인 스크립트를 다시 실행하려고 할 때 발생합니다. 이럴 경우 -f 옵션을 추가하여 강제로 다시 실행시키면 됩니다. 따라서, 다음과 같이 명령어를 입력해보세요.

pm2 start main.js –watch -f

이렇게 하면 현재 실행 중인 스크립트를 강제로 종료하고 다시 실행하게 됩니다.

만약에 계속해서 오류가 발생하거나 해결되지 않는다면, pm2를 재시작하거나 서버를 재부팅해보시는 것도 좋은 방법입니다.

그리고 참고로 pm2 –watch 옵션을 사용하면 파일 변경이 감지될 때 자동으로 재시작되므로 -f 옵션을 사용할 필요가 없습니다.

해당 내용이 도움이 되었길 바랍니다. 감사합니다.

존재하지 않는 일기 url입력 시 alert이 두 번 떠요

0

22

1

교재(3쇄)와 강의 내용 문의

0

30

2

call stack 표현이 잘못표현된것이 아닌가요?

0

66

2

전자책으로 구매인증 가능할까요?

0

72

1

4주차 미션 게시판이 안보여요~

0

46

2

혹시 다음 강의 제작 예정된 것들이 있을까요?

0

81

1

에러 질문드립니다

0

63

2

1강 질문

0

70

2

책에 있는 프롬프트 관련 질문입니다.

0

49

2

ai가 만든 강의인가요?

0

147

1

VSCode 설정 문의

0

66

2

수파베이스 ORM 질문

0

55

2

몽고 db 접속 오류

0

29

1

트리거 질문

0

48

1

3강 질문

0

80

2

2강 nodejs 3단계 설명 질문

0

92

1

useEffect와 lifecycle문의

0

63

2

프론트엔드 학습 수준 문의

0

77

2

리액트 챕터별 코드에서 eslint 설정파일이 없어요

0

69

2

fetchBoardsOfMine, fetchBoardsCountOfMine 에러 문의드립니다

0

62

1

데이터 로딩중 화면만 계속 나와요!!

0

72

2

퍼블리셔일경우 어느정도 수준까지 강의를 들어야할까요

0

99

2

질문

0

444

1

강의감사합니다.

0

370

1